Very high DHEAS … WebAbstract Background: Dehydroepiandrosterone (DHEA) and its sulphate DHEAS are the most abundant sex steroids in women and provide a large reservoir of precursors for the intracellular production of androgens and estrogens in non-reproductive tissues. Levels of DHEA and DHEAS decline with age.

Symptoms of high SHBG are similar to those of low male sex hormone levels. The symptoms of high SHBG vary between men and women. In both, however, it may cause decreased sex drive, infertility, reduced bone and muscle mass, and decreased energy levels.
